Web-Страница тормозит при отображении множества слоев

Mapserver, GeoServer, MapGuide, Google и другое ПО для веб-картографии
Ответить
Marina
Интересующийся
Сообщения: 15
Зарегистрирован: 30 мар 2009, 11:10
Репутация: 0

Web-Страница тормозит при отображении множества слоев

Сообщение Marina » 07 сен 2013, 15:27

Здравствуйте.
Используется mapserver, который тянет данные из PostGIS.
Каждый слой описан в map файле отдельным запросом к базе.
http://hntu.com.ua/index.php/info
Помогите разобраться: откуда тормоза и как с этим справиться?
Спасибо.

ericsson
Гуру
Сообщения: 3321
Зарегистрирован: 27 июл 2009, 19:26
Репутация: 748
Ваше звание: Вредитель полей

Re: Web-Страница тормозит при отображении множества слоев

Сообщение ericsson » 07 сен 2013, 16:31

Потому openlayers и тормозит, что слоев целая куча. Вы уверены, что какие-то из них нельзя объединить?

Marina
Интересующийся
Сообщения: 15
Зарегистрирован: 30 мар 2009, 11:10
Репутация: 0

Re: Web-Страница тормозит при отображении множества слоев

Сообщение Marina » 07 сен 2013, 16:43

Ericsson, спасибо большое за ответ. Можно конечно и объединить, но слои создавались с целью раскрасить разные типы участков по разному. А может Вы подскажете, как можно уменьшить количество тайлов в слое или как-то решить вопрос с кэшированием?

ericsson
Гуру
Сообщения: 3321
Зарегистрирован: 27 июл 2009, 19:26
Репутация: 748
Ваше звание: Вредитель полей

Re: Web-Страница тормозит при отображении множества слоев

Сообщение ericsson » 07 сен 2013, 17:17

Вообще-то, чтобы "раскрасить по-разному", каждый тип объектов вовсе не должен быть на отдельном слое.
Уменьшать нужно не количество тайлов, а количество слоев, которые передаются с сервера клиенту.

Ответить

Вернуться в «Веб-картография»

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и 2 гостя